What would you do if condensate overflows in aircon unit?

If condensate overflows in an air conditioning unit, you should first turn off the unit to prevent any further damage. Then, locate the condensate drain line and check for any obstructions that may be causing the overflow. Clear the blockage if possible, or contact a professional for assistance if needed. Finally, clean up any water that has leaked to prevent any damage to your home.

What is Condensate spiked with oil?

Condensate spiked with oil refers to a mixture where condensate, a light hydrocarbon liquid recovered from natural gas, is contaminated or mixed with oil. This mixture can occur in production processes or due to equipment failure, and may require separation or treatment to extract the oil component.

What is the purpose of the condensate line in an air conditioning system and how does it help in maintaining the efficiency of the AC unit?

The condensate line in an air conditioning system helps to remove excess moisture that is produced during the cooling process. This moisture, known as condensate, is drained through the condensate line to prevent it from accumulating and causing damage to the AC unit. By efficiently removing the condensate, the condensate line helps maintain the proper functioning of the AC unit and prevents issues such as mold growth and reduced efficiency.

What is RVP condensate?

There isn't RVP condensate. Condensate is the hydrocarbon liquid that comes out of the ground at gas wells. RVP is a measure of the amount of "light ends" in the liquid. RVP is roughly a measure of how light or heavy oil is, or how long the carbon chains are.


What is condensate yield?

Condensate yield refers to the amount of liquid (condensate) produced from natural gas or oil during processing and separation. It is commonly expressed as the volume or percentage of condensate recovered from the raw natural gas or oil. Achieving a high condensate yield is important for maximizing the value of the produced hydrocarbons.


How can I access the condensate drain pan?

To access the condensate drain pan, locate the air conditioning unit and remove the access panel. The condensate drain pan is typically located underneath the unit. You may need to unscrew or lift the pan to access and clean it. Be sure to turn off the power to the unit before attempting any maintenance.
